Seek Medical Attention Right Away
Seeing a doctor after an accident is important, even if your injuries seem minor. This ensures that any injuries are documented in your medical records. Prompt medical care helps to prevent long-term complications and shows that you took your health seriously after the accident.

Delaying medical attention can hurt your claim. If you wait too long, the insurance company may argue that your injuries are not as serious. Immediate medical care provides the evidence needed to support your case.
Document Everything
Collecting evidence after the accident is essential for building your case. Take photos of the accident scene, any damage to your vehicle, and your injuries. Keep track of medical visits, bills, and any treatments you receive.
You should also document any lost time from work due to your injuries. Write down details about the accident while they are still fresh in your memory. This information can be used later to strengthen your claim.

Avoid Accepting the First Offer
Insurance companies often make a low initial offer to settle quickly. It is important not to accept this offer without considering whether it covers all your expenses. A lawyer can help you determine if the first offer is fair or if you should seek more.
Settling too early can mean missing out on additional compensation for future medical costs or lost wages. A lawyer will evaluate your case and provide advice on the best strategy. They will make sure you are not pressured into settling for less than you deserve.
Know Your Insurance Coverage
Understanding your insurance coverage is important for maximizing your car injury settlement. Many policies have provisions for medical payments and uninsured motorist protection. Knowing these details helps you understand what financial support is available to you.
If the at-fault driver is underinsured or uninsured, your own coverage may provide additional funds. Review your policy before the accident so you are prepared for the claims process. Having this knowledge can make a significant difference in the outcome of your case.
